A private network, on the other hand, guarantees the quality of the service. This type of network typically consists of a super head-end that coordinates the whole service. The main office is linked to regional distribution offices. These offices distribute content to set-top boxes in individual homes.

Privacy concerns
Privacy concerns with IPTV services are a growing concern for users. This article discusses some of the potential threats. It also provides an overview of the IPTV system.
A service provider must address IPTV security issues in multiple areas. These include the delivery and management networks, subscriber assets, and the content assets.
The Security and Content Protection Working Group has made some progress on these issues. They list the various types of assets and suggest methods for reducing risks.
A PKI system using AES encryption provides the most secure environment. However, it can be hard to implement. If the service provider uses Kerberos as an authentication mechanism, there are weaknesses in its security.
There are many ways that IPTV can be hacked. One common technique is to use fake playback buttons that link to external sites. This can lead to malware and viruses being installed on the user’s device.
Authentication of user devices is vital to protect IPTV services. In addition, it is important to ensure QoS. Secure mutual authentication for IPTV broadcasting relies on attributes that are generated during the registration process.
